Standard tax code 1257L, no student loan. NHS pension is a Net Pay Arrangement (deducted before PAYE); NI is charged on the full pensionable gross. Layer pension tiers, HCAS and student loans live in the NHS calculator.
| Line item | National | Outer London | Inner London |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pensionable gross | £39,959 | £45,953 | £47,951 |
| HCAS supplement | £0 | £5,994 | £7,992 |
| NHS pension | £3,916 | £4,503 | £4,699 |
| Income tax (PAYE) | £4,695 | £5,776 | £6,136 |
| National Insurance | £2,191 | £2,671 | £2,830 |
| Annual take-home | £29,157 | £33,003 | £34,285 |
| Monthly take-home | £2,430 | £2,750 | £2,857 |
